Suddenly downsized from her corporate telecom career, Sue Kenney walked 780 kilometers on a medieval pilgrimage route in Spain known as the Camino de Santiago de Compostela. She went alone in the winter on a quest in search of self-love and ultimately, more meaning in her life. This is her story. A 45 year old mother of three teen-aged daughters, a competitive master rower and a business woman, she left the comfort of her familiar life in Toronto to venture into the unknown. The word Camino means the way. Pilgrims of the past followed this path to Santiago, where the remains of the St. James were alleged to be buried. They believed if they were close to the remains of an Apostle they would be closer to God. Sue decided she wasn’t going on this pilgrimage for religious reasons, but rather on a journey to discover her inner self. She left knowing she would start in St. Jean Pied de Port and she would walk to Santiago, Spain. But, she had no idea about how she was going to face the physical challenge of walking 20-40 kilometers a day to get to her destination. Through the tales of her journey, we learn how Sue experiences the Camino as a metaphor for a celebration of one's life. Over 29 days, she attempts to remain open to all possibilities and experiences astonishing insights and lessons that completely shift her perspective about what's important in life. After the Camino she returned home and established a deep connection with nature. She wrote her first book, My Camino, originally published by White Knight Books and now a feature film in development. Her second book is about another Camino on the Portuguese Route called Confessions of a Pilgrim and she has produced a feature length documentary film Las Peregrinas. She now lives a barefoot lifestyle and has coached and guided numerous groups on the Camino. She became known as Barefoot Sue after her 15 second video she went viral on TikTok.
